Embedding problem between right-angled Artin groups

Published 11 Apr 2023 in math.GR, math.CO, and math.MG | (2304.05267v1)

Abstract: Given a graph $\Gamma$, the right-angled Artin group $A(\Gamma)$ is given by the presentation $\langle u \in V(\Gamma) \mid [u,v]=1, \ {u,v} \in E(\Gamma) \rangle$. The Embedding Problem in right-angled Artin groups asks, given two finite graphs $\Phi,\Psi$, how to determine whether or not $A(\Phi)$ is isomorphic to a subgroup of $A(\Psi)$. These are the notes of a mini-course given at the CIRM in April 2022, dedicated to a geometric point of view on this embedding problem, based on quasi-median graphs.
